Experiencing Changes in Temperature Level
Your hot water heater has a thermostat, and also the water produced ought to stay around that exact same temperature you set for the system. Nevertheless, if your water ends up being too cold or also warm all of a sudden, it can imply that your water heater thermostat is no more doing its task. So first, test points out by utilizing a pen as well as tape. Examine to see later on if the noting steps on its own. If it does, it suggests your heating system is unsteady.
Making Insufficient Warm Water
If there is inadequate hot water for you and also your household, yet you haven't transformed your intake practices, then that's the sign that your hot water heater is failing. Usually, expanding families as well as an additional washroom suggest that you need to scale as much as a larger device to satisfy your needs.
When whatever is the same, however your water heater unexpectedly does not satisfy your warm water requirements, take into consideration a professional examination because your maker is not doing to standard.
Seeing Leakages and also Puddles
Check to screws, pipelines, and also connectors when you see a water leak. You may simply require to tighten a few of them. Nonetheless, if you see pools gathered at the bottom of the home heating device, you must require an instant examination due to the fact that it reveals you've got an energetic leakage that could be a concern with your container itself or the pipes.
Hearing Strange Seems
When uncommon sounds like knocking as well as touching on your maker, this shows debris build-up. It belongs to stratified rocks, which are tough and also make a great deal of sound when banging versus steel. If left neglected, these items can develop tears on the steel, creating leakages.
You can still conserve your water heating unit by draining it as well as cleaning it. Just be careful due to the fact that dealing with this is unsafe, whether it is a gas or electrical system.

Aging Past Requirement Life Expectancy
You have to think about replacing it if your water heating system is more than 10 years old. That's the natural life-span of this device! With proper upkeep, you can prolong it for a few more years. On the other hand, without a routine tune-up, the lifespan can be much shorter. You may consider hot water heater replacement if you know your hot water heater is old, combined with the other concerns discussed over.

WHAT CAUSES A WATER HEATER TO BREAK?
Whether gas or electric, water heaters typically last 10-13 years – if you pay attention to them. Sometimes, a water heater will start leaking near the supply lines, and if you don't correct the leak, it could not only damage your surrounding floor and drywall but also lead to corrosion and failure. Other common causes of water heater failure are internal rust, sediment buildup and high water pressure. Improper sizing can also cause your water heater to burst unexpectedly, leaving you with a huge, expensive mess.
